{"ob_id":44952,"uuid":"d44ae8c7cb4e41fb99779886e3008951","title":"Space Weather Instrumentation, Measurement, Modelling and Risk (SWIMMR) - Thermosphere\"","abstract":"The Space Weather Instrumentation, Measurement, Modelling and Risk - Thermosphere (SWIMMR-T) project is a \"Research to Operations\" (R2O) initiative designed to improve the UK’s ability to monitor and forecast the Earth’s thermosphere (the atmospheric layer from ~90 km to 1,000 km). While this region is the primary environment for Low Earth Orbit (LEO) satellites, it is highly sensitive to solar activity and long-term climate change. The project’s main goal is to provide the Met Office Space Weather Operations Centre (MOSWOC) with high-fidelity models to predict satellite drag and prevent orbital collisions.","keywords":"","status":"completed","publicationState":"published","identifier_set":[],"observationCollection":[],"parentProject":null,"subProject":[],"responsiblepartyinfo_set":["https://catalogue.ceda.ac.uk/api/v2/rpis/215357/?format=json","https://catalogue.ceda.ac.uk/api/v2/rpis/215358/?format=json","https://catalogue.ceda.ac.uk/api/v2/rpis/215359/?format=json"]}
